Deenwood, Georgia Climate Data

Deenwood, Georgia has a Humid Subtropical Climate climate (Köppen classification: Cfa). Average annual temperatures range from 55.5 °F (low) to 79 °F (high). Annual precipitation averages 49.3 Inches. Deenwood is located in USDA Plant Hardiness Zone 9a. The growing season typically runs from the last frost around Mar. 1 - Mar. 10 through the first frost around Nov. 21 - Nov. 30.
